Azerbaijan imports below 1mln KW-h per day from Russia

# 01 June 2007 13:11 (UTC +04:00)
Azerbaijan is importing less than 1 million kilowatts of electricity per day from Russia at present, said Etibar Pirverdiyev, President of Azerenergy.
“Russia tried to increase prices. We haggled and beat down the prices in April. According to the agreement, Azerbaijan is also exporting electricity to Russia in peak hours at the same price,” he added.
Inter RAO EES, a subsidiary of Russia’s RAO EES (Unified Energy Systems) and Azerenergy, Azerbaijan’s State Electricity Company, came on April 27 to an agreement in Baku for electricity imports and exports after the long-drawn-out price-haggling negotiations. /APA-Economics/
